Introduction to Dry Mortar Additive Construction Grade Hydroxypropyl Methyl Cellulose HPMC Used in Wall Putty
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ose (HPMC), whose Chinese name is hydroxypropyl methylcellulose, is a semi-synthetic, non-ionic cellulose ether obtained by chemically modifying natural cellulose. This white powder can form a transparent viscous solution after dissolving in water. It has excellent thickening, water retention, stability and film-forming properties. It is an indispensable multifunctional additive in many fields such as construction, medicine, and food.
Characteristics and advantages of Dry Mortar Additive Construction Grade Hydroxypropyl Methyl Cellulose HPMC Used in Wall Putty
Excellent water solubility: It can be quickly dissolved in cold water to form a clear and stable solution.
Efficient thickening and water retention ability: Increase the viscosity of the material, effectively reduce water evaporation, and improve work efficiency.
Good stability: It has good stability to acids, alkalis, and salts, and is suitable for a wide range of pH values.
Film-forming and protective effects: After drying, it forms a tough and transparent film to protect the substrate and prevent water penetration and evaporation.
Non-toxic and non-irritating: It has good biocompatibility and is suitable for the fields of medicine and food.
Adjustability: By changing the degree of substitution and molecular weight, its performance can be adjusted to meet different application requirements.

Application of Dry Mortar Additive Construction Grade Hydroxypropyl Methyl Cellulose HPMC Used in Wall Putty
Construction industry: As an additive for cement mortar, it improves the construction performance of tile adhesive, putty powder, self-leveling mortar, etc.
Pharmaceutical industry: Used as tablet coating material, adhesive, disintegrant to improve the stability and release characteristics of drugs.
Food industry: As a stabilizer, thickener and film former, it is used in ice cream, jam, baked goods, etc.
Cosmetics industry: As a thickener and film former, it is used in products such as lotions, creams, shampoos, etc. to enhance the texture of products.
Textile and papermaking industry: As a sizing agent and sizing agent, it improves the processing performance of fibers and the quality of paper.
